Our client is a global leader in automatic test equipment, and this newly-expanded R&D team exists for one purpose: to develop the test concepts that don't exist yet.

You won't be maintaining production test programs, you'll be taking a blank page, a customer's half-formed problem, and turning it into a working prototype, a technology demonstrator, and very often a patent application.

  • What makes this different
  • New concepts, not maintenance: This isn't incremental application engineering.

Every project starts from "what if".

New test methodologies for technologies that haven't been productised yet, from high-speed digital interfaces to electro-optical and silicon photonics test.

  • Your ideas become IP: You'll be encouraged to file for patents on the ideas you develop.

If you want your engineering work to leave a lasting, attributable footprint, this is a rare place to do it.

  • Full ownership of the journey: Projects run 1–2 years, from feasibility study through proof-of-concept and into direct engagement with lead customers and technology partners.

You will see your work through from idea to demonstration.

  • Hands-on across hardware and software: This role deliberately spans hardware (PCB design for DUT boards and probe cards), software, and test physics.

You'll build the board, write the code, and prove the concept.

  • A real innovation playground: Low bureaucracy, direct access to internal stakeholders and external partners, and genuine freedom to pursue the ideas you believe in.
  • What you'll be doing
  • Develop and prototype innovative semiconductor test solutions and methodologies for emerging technologies and applications.
  • Validate and implement new test concepts on a leading industrial test platform, from feasibility study through proof-of-concept demonstration and customer engagement.
  • Collaborate with customers, technology partners, and internal organisations to identify and address future test challenges.
  • Work across business units to accelerate innovation and solution development.
  • Contribute to the generation of intellectual property, technology demonstrators, and future product concepts, including formal patent applications.
  • Analyse industry trends and help define the next generation of semiconductor test solutions.
  • What you'll bring
  • Master's degree or Ph D in Electrical Engineering, Physics, Mechatronics, Microelectronics, Semiconductor Engineering, Computer Engineering, Microsystems Engineering, Materials Science, or a related discipline and equivalent experience is also considered.
  • Hands-on experience with a leading industrial ATE platform, with a focus on high-speed, RF, or electro-optical applications.

Having proven strength in one of these three is enough to build on.

  • PCB design experience for DUT boards or probe cards is a strong plus, though not essential.
  • Working knowledge of high-speed digital interfaces such as PCIe, UCIe, Ethernet, USB, or CXL, and the measurement techniques behind them.
  • A solid grounding in semiconductor devices, advanced packaging, and test methodology — plus real curiosity about where the industry is heading next.
  • Comfort working across teams, cultures, and organisational levels, and a genuine appetite for creative problem-solving.
  • Fluent English; German is an advantage.
  • Willingness to travel occasionally (up to around 20%), including to Asia and the US, to work directly with customers and partners.
